Justyna Regan Appointed as an Officer of the Advocates Society

The law firm of Hinshaw & Culbertson LLP is pleased to announce that partner Justyna Regan, PhD, has been appointed to be an Officer of the Advocates Society, serving as the Historian for the 2025–2026 term. She was officially sworn in on February 28, 2025 at the recent Advocates Society’s Annual Installation ceremony.
The Advocates Society is an association of Polish-American attorneys dedicated to promoting member welfare, fostering public relationships, advancing legal progress, upholding the legal profession's dignity, and celebrating Polish-American culture and heritage.
Justyna provides legal counsel in international trade, cross-border transactions, mergers and acquisitions, business law, and data privacy matters. She is a former Fulbright scholar and a law professor. In addition to the Advocates Society, Justyna is a member of several organizations, including the Chicago Bar Association, Illinois State Bar Association, International Bar Association, and Wroclaw District Bar of Legal Counsel.
